#cd7998 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#cd7998 is composed of 80.4% red, 47.5% green and 59.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 41% magenta, 25.9% yellow and 19.6% black. It has a hue angle of 337.9 degrees, a saturation of 45.7% and a lightness of 63.9%. #cd7998 color hex could be obtained by blending #fff2ff with #9b0031. Closest websafe color is: #cc6699.

● #cd7998 color description : Slightly desaturated pink.
#cd7998 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#cd7998 has RGB values of R:205, G:121, B:152 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.41, Y:0.26, K:0.2. Its decimal value is 13466008.

Shades and Tints of #cd7998
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#090305 is the darkest color, while #fdfafb is the lightest one.

Tones of #cd7998
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#aa9ca1 is the less saturated color, while #ff478b is the most saturated one.
